iReport: como ele ignorar a margem inferior?

6 respostas
P

Opa :smiley:

Estou tentando gerar etiquetas pimaco mas o jasper insiste em manter uma margem inferior no pdf. Já tentei colocar 0 e ele não reconhece que estou fazendo isso e qdo imprimo o pdf, fica com uma margem enorme embaixo :frowning:

Alguém já passou por isso?

Obrigado

6 Respostas

A

Amigo,
Pode não ser a margem inferior seu problema. O jasper pode estar “subindo” o conteúdo da página devido a algum espaço em branco acima desse conteudo. Ele não gosta que deixe espaço em branco entre a margem superior e o elemento mais alto na pagina, ele simplesmente tira o espaço. Isso pode te dar a impressão de que foi a margem inferior que cresceu, quando na realidade foi o conteudo que subiu. Felizmente existe solução atribuindo uma propriedade que define se os objetos terão um posicionamento relativo ou fixo. Não me lembro qual é agora mas nada complicado de descobrir.
Espero ter ajudado! :smiley:

P

Po, puta explicação essa :smiley: … mto boa

Então parece que por default, ele vem com algo do tipo ‘posicionamento relativo’ né?

P

Amigo, experimentar aumentar o tamanho da minha coluna do details para ver se o jasper ia respeitar o espaço em branco e ele manteve o espaço em branco e continua não respeitando a minha margem 0 :frowning:

A

É isso ai… ele vem com esse tipo de posicionamento padrão sim. Na documentação do jasper você encontra esses valores padrão. :wink:

P

blz :smiley:

Agora botei uma margem superior e ele jogou tudo lá pra baixo e deixou a margem inferior zerada mesmo…vou ver aqui como resolver o danadão :smiley:

A

Ele também redimensiona o detail! rsrsrs :smiley:
Ele vai suprimir o detail até o máximo que ele puder, retirando espaços em branco acima e abaixo dos elementos.

Criado 13 de fevereiro de 2009
Ultima resposta 13 de fev. de 2009
Respostas 6
Participantes 2